Default Electrical question

passenger side window will go down but will not go up (green =+ yellow =-)


Change poles on motor (yellow=+ green =-) window goes up, but will not go down


What is dead that will allow motor to work as it should by changing pole position? HELP!!!

There's either something wrong with your switch (could just be in need of cleaning) or you have a busted wire somewhere (the rubber boot where the wires go into the door is a problem spot).
